Clark Forklift Attachments - Performing worldwide, there are now 350,000 Clark forklifts and lift vehicles in operation, with more than 250,000 of those in service in North America. Clark has five major lines of lift trucks across the globe, making it one of the most expansive corporations in the industry. Heavy duty trucks ranging from 1,500lb to 18,000lb capacities, duel fuel, gasoline, LPG, hand powered lift trucks, narrow-aisle stackers and electric riders are a few of their specialties.
Clark Totalift, handles more than 120,000 specific items intended for 20 distinctive models of forklifts and automated equipment. Your regional Clark Dealer is your total source for availability of all your parts needs offered by Clark Totalift.
Clark features a exceptional Parts Supply team. The parts warehouses are conveniently located in Changwon, South Korea and Louisville, Kentucky to guarantee exceptional service to both their customers and their dealers. Worldwide, Clark has one of the most outstanding dealer support networks. With over 550 locations worldwide, dealer representation in over 80 countries and 230 locations in North America, their high level of dedication to their clients predominates the material handling market.
By revolutionizing the operator restraint system safety feature, Clark proudly remains a leader of innovation in the industrial equipment and automated lift truck industry. This exceptional dedication to safety is at this time a standard feature on every lift truck.
Clark's recurrent goal to boast the No. 1 Quality system in the industry is proudly demonstrated by ISO 9001 - Clark, is the first lift truck producer across the world to be certified with the internationally approved quality standard ISO 9001 for every one of their production plants. Furthermore, the ISO 14001 Environmental Stewardship System certificate was awarded to Clark's Korean facility in 2001. This paramount achievement enables Clark to be ready for any environmental restrictions, thus placing them in a prevailing market position.
Clark has preferred the particularly economical and beneficial system of "Lean Manufacturing" for its assembly plants and application of resources. This system was developed to acknowledge the most effective method of manufacturing facility stewardship and ensuring maximum efficiency. Clark has concluded this transition of its Korean plant. COPS which is Clark Optimized Production System, similarly focuses on quality of product and services and production efficiencies.
Clark's product engineers and suppliers communicate together to improve the efficiency and excellence of their products while minimizing expenses. The new value engineering program combines modern product development and offers superior customer support and service within the industry.
